Clean Aligners Daily

When it comes to proper Invisalign care, it is important to ensure that your aligners are kept clean to maximize and reap the benefits of getting Invisalign. A patient should clean their aligners daily with lukewarm water and a soft-bristled toothbrush.

First, remove the aligner from the mouth and rinse it thoroughly with lukewarm water. Then, brush the whole aligner gently with the soft-bristled toothbrush and clear liquid hand soap. Be careful not to move the bristles too hard, as this can damage the material of the aligner.

Once the aligner is clean, rinse it off with lukewarm water and tap it on the palm of your hand to remove any excess water. Finally, let the aligner air dry before reinserting it. Plaque buildup on your aligners can lead to discoloration and odor, so it is important to clean them regularly.

Brush Teeth Regularly

Brushing teeth regularly is an essential part of basic Invisalign care in order to maintain oral health. Not brushing your teeth will result in plaque, which can build up and cause tooth decay.

Brush your teeth at least twice daily with fluoride toothpaste—floss at least once a day to remove food particles and bacteria. Brush your teeth for at least two minutes to ensure that plaque is removed and your smile will look brighter.

Store Aligners Properly

Storing aligners properly is one of the most important steps for proper Invisalign care. When you are not wearing your aligners, it is important to keep them in the case that was provided by your orthodontic clinic. Avoid leaving them in plain sight or anywhere where they may be exposed to strong temperatures, humidity, and excessive light.

Avoid contact with water, as this may result in warping or discoloration. Keep them away from pets and any other substances, such as lotion or hairspray. Always wash your hands before handling your aligners, and handle them with care to avoid damaging them. By following these basic steps, you will help ensure your Invisalign treatment is successful.
